It does not directly deal with more serious fertility issues. Fertility services are a personalized procedure and outcomes will vary from individual to person. Sperm problems and advanced age in the lady might decrease the success rate of cycle monitoring. Typically, if three medicated cycle tracking treatments have not rendered favorable results, you may need to reevaluate whether further treatment options, such as IVF and IUI, are necessary to increase your chances of getting pregnant.

There are a lot of various elements that could be at play with a failure to develop. These include: Ovulation period: You might not be ovulating throughout the times that you are trying to conceive.
You might also have irregular ovulation durations (dumpster rental). A fertility specialist can assist you know when you are most fertile. Male infertility: Your male partner might be sterile due to varicocele (a condition in which the veins on the testicles are too big), low sperm count, or he may have a disease or condition that impacts his sperm.

"Your regional fertility center may not be the very best center around, and it deserves doing your homework," says Dr. Thomas A. Molinaro, a reproductive endocrinologist at Reproductive Medicine Associates of New Jersey in Eatontown, New Jersey. He suggests logging onto the website of the Society for Assisted Reproductive Innovation. The federal government needs fertility centers to report their IVF treatment cycle success rate, and you can find those stats on the site.

"Although it's tempting, it's not always the very best concept to pick a center based on your insurance coverage," Turek states.
If a facility does not list its outcomes or does not seem fully transparent, consider it a red flag. It may suggest the center does not have excellent outcomes. However, results for fertility might depend extremely on selection of patients and their fertility risk elements. If possible, ask about the success rates for others in your position.
"In lots of areas of surgical treatment, volume suggests know-how. It's not an absolute guideline, however it is a consideration when assessing program quality." Inquire about how numerous treatments the center does each year. There's no standard relating to volume, he says. However, he adds that a fertility clinic that does fewer than 100 procedures yearly to be a low-volume clinic.
Price is constantly a consideration, however you should likewise weigh what you get for your money - dumpster rental. "It's not about the most affordable program. It has to do with what you're getting for your money, which's a worth proposal," Turek says. "If you invest 25% more for a 50% greater pregnancy rate, that might be a better offer for you."Good clinics with high success rates may cost more up front, but may get you pregnant much faster and at a lower expense in the long run instead of paying for numerous treatments.
